A solution of borane in tetrahydrofuran (1M, 30.7 ml) was added dropwise to a stirred solution of diastereomer 1 (2R)-2-[(S)-(3-fluorophenyl)(hydroxy)methyl]-4-benzylmorpholin-3-one and (2S)-2-[(R)-(3-fluorophenyl)(hydroxy)methyl]-4-benzylmorpholin-3-one (2.42 g 7.68 mmol) in dried tetrahydrofuran (30 ml) at room temperature under nitrogen causing effervesence. The solution was heated to 60° C. for 2 h, allowed to cool to room temperature and excess borane quenched by adding methanol (15 ml) slowly. Aqueous hydrochloric acid (1M, 15 ml) was added, heated to 60° C. for 1 h and then evaporated to a white solid. Added saturated aqueous sodium carbonate (50 ml) and diethyl ether (50 ml) to dissolve the solid and extracted with diethyl ether (2×50 ml). The extracts were washed with brine solution, dried, filtered and evaporated to a colourless oil (2.38 g). The oil was purified by chromatography on silica eluting with diethyl ether:hexane 75:25 to give (R)-[3-fluorophenyl][(2R)-4-benzylmorpholin-2-yl]methanol and (S)-[3-fluorophenyl][(2S)-4-benzylmorpholin-2-yl]methanol as a colourless oil (2.23 g)
